This article will compare and analyze NetEase Snail Reading and WeChat Reading in three scenarios: before reading, during reading and after reading, and try to find the possible development direction of NetEase Snail Reading. I. Overview NetEase Snail Reading is a new reading product launched by NetEase. This reading app can read for one hour for free every day. It focuses on the in-depth reading of high-quality published books in the dimension of "time is paid". NetEase Snail Reading is committed to building a three-dimensional and all-round mobile reading community to meet the personalized reading needs of users at different reading levels. Analysis time: December 25, 2018 OS: Android 6.0.1 2. Comparative analysis 2.1 Functional structure diagram Netease snail reading Snail Reading and WeChat Reading are divided into 4 tab navigations. Except for the same "I" and "
Bookshelf/Desk", NetEase Snail Reading has set up "Leading" and "Category" navigation respectively. The books users read are more from Recommended by reading experts (lead reading) and popular recommendation (on the reading list/new book list), and focus on building the leading reading function, hoping to build this into a circle of reading experts; while WeChat reading additionally sets "discovery" and "ideas" navigation , pay more attention to the interaction between friends. 2.2 Before reading The main needs of users before reading are to find books and read book reviews.
